Output 8e34ccbb2a356ee6bb48784040e2d9d68e0728ab4c27905d0c473faeb5c7ae38:1

value
638560000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 68fa3bb2c2801c944b1e3de628ef7de5022235cd OP_EQUALVERIFY OP_CHECKSIG
address
DEiAaiVCUaYk4hRs1FkkV5YJpyBDSh9LuC
transaction
8e34ccbb2a356ee6bb48784040e2d9d68e0728ab4c27905d0c473faeb5c7ae38